00:02Tesla CEO Elon Musk said the company's Roadster unveiling on October 1st could far exceed
00:08expectations. Musk told the All In podcast that,
00:10Success is not guaranteed, but excitement is. Host Jason Calacanis said a preview of
00:15the demonstration would blow people's minds, while Musk said Tesla needs an audience to
00:19confirm the demonstration is not AI-generated. The billionaire has teased the Roadster as a
00:23flying car, with technology surpassing James Bond's fictional vehicles. Tesla was granted
00:28a patent last year for an active aerodynamic system that could generate downforce using
00:32fans and potentially make a vehicle hover by reversing airflow. Musk also hinted at a possible
00:37Tesla-SpaceX merger, citing collaboration between the companies. Tesla shares fell 0.48% to $357.24
